What is the cheapest month to fly from New York to Greece?

To calculate monthly average prices, KAYAK takes all prices for each month over the last year for round-trip flights from New York to Greece, removes the top 0.1% to account for outliers, and then takes the median of all values for each month.

The cheapest month for flights from New York to Greece is October, when tickets cost $515 (return) on average. On the other hand, the most expensive months are June and December, when the average cost of round-trip tickets is $987 and $873 respectively.

FAQs - booking Greece flights

  • Will I need a passport to travel from New York to Greece and do I need to obtain a visa before my trip?

    The United States State Department recommends that your passport be valid for at least 180 days beyond your date of travel to Greece. Your passport needs to have a couple of blank pages for entry stamps. If you are traveling to Greece on a vacation as a tourist and you do not plan on staying in the country for more than 90 days, you will not need a visa to travel there.

  • If I'm going to be flying to Athens Eleftherios V. Airport, are there any public transportation options to get me from the airport to the center of Athens?

    One of the most cost-effective ways to get from the airport to the center of Athens is aboard the blue metro line that can take you to te center of Athens in about 40-50min and departs from the airport every 30-35min. The cost for the ride is about 10 € ($12).

  • What other international airports are there in Greece that I can travel too?

    The biggest and busiest international airport in Greece is Athens Elefterios V.Airport (ATH), but if you want to travel to Crete, Greece's biggest island, you have the option to either use Heraklion Airport (HER) or Chania Airport (CHQ). One more option that covers the northern part of Greece is Thessaloniki Airport (SKG).

  • If my final destination is the very popular island of Santorini in Greece, what is the best way for me to get there?

    Certainly, one of the quickest ways to make this trip is to book a one-stop flight that departs from New York and has a layover at Athens Eleftherios V. Airport before arriving at Thera Santorini Airport (JTR). If you are looking for a more leisurely journey, book a flight to Athens, and then take the ferry offered by Blue Star Ferries that makes the journey from Athens to Santorini in around 7h 30min for a cost of about 60 € ($70).

Top tips for finding cheap flights to Greece

  • While there are several airports in Greece that you can travel to on one and two-stop flights from New York, the only airport that you can fly directly to from New York is Athens Eleftherios V. Airport (ATH). All of the direct flights originate from Newark International Airport (EWR).
  • When looking for a quick and convenient way to get from Manhattan to John F. Kennedy International Airport (JFK), there are several subway lines that make the trip from New York Penn Station to the Jamaica Station. From there you can take the JFK AirTrain to the terminal buildings.
  • If you are looking for a place to relax before a long flight to Greece, there are two spa locations at Newark International Airport in Terminal C that allow you to indulge in spa services, such as a massage, before your flight.
  • If you are planning on driving yourself to John F. Kennedy International Airport, the airport offers both on-site lots as well as much more cost-effective offsite lots that offer free shuttle service to and from the terminal buildings.
  • If you have an early flight to Greece from Newark International Airport and you do not want the hassle that comes with the early morning commute to the airport, there is a hotel on-site in the terminal building at the airport.
